Многие клиентские инструменты с графическим интерфейсом, такие как pgAdmin, Omni DB и т. д., помогают пользователям легко управлять данными и манипулировать ими. Но все же люди предпочитают использовать командную строку для доступа к базе данных PostgreSQL. psql — известный клиентский инструмент командной строки для PostgreSQL.
В этом блоге мы покажем, как установить только клиентские инструменты для PostgreSQL в Windows:
Способ 1: использование сжатых двоичных файлов PostgreSQL
Двоичные файлы PostgreSQL используются для установки и настройки клиентских инструментов PostgreSQL в Windows, например, двоичный файл «psql.exe» используется для установки клиентских инструментов командной строки. Чтобы установить только клиентские инструменты для PostgreSQL в Windows, следуйте приведенным ниже инструкциям.
Шаг 1: Загрузите установочный файл
Перейдите по указанной ниже ссылке, чтобы загрузить сжатую установку для PostgreSQL в Windows:
https: // www.enterprisedb.com / скачать-postgresql-двоичные файлы
Шаг 2. Извлеките файл Zip Setup
Перейти к « Загрузки », щелкните правой кнопкой мыши ZIP-файл установки PostgreSQL и выберите « Извлечь все ” из отображаемой опции:
Укажите место, куда вы хотите извлечь установку PostgreSQL:
Шаг 3. Удалите ненужные каталоги
Чтобы установить только клиентские инструменты, удалите выделенные папки, как показано ниже.
Шаг 4: Откройте каталог bin
Вы можете видеть, что теперь есть только два каталога, общий и bin. Откройте каталог bin:
Шаг 5. Удалите ненужные двоичные файлы и файлы библиотек.
Удалите все файлы .exe, кроме psql.exe. Перечисленные ниже DLL-файлы необходимы для выполнения команды PostgreSQL с помощью инструмента командной строки. Поэтому удалите все остальные бинарные файлы и dll-файлы, кроме упомянутых файлов:
- libcrypto-1_1-x64.dll
- libiconv-2.dll
- libintl-9.dll
- libpq.dll
- libssl-1_1-x64.dll
- libwinpthread-1.dll
- psql.exe
- zlib1.dll
Если вы хотите сохранить некоторые клиентские инструменты, вы можете сохранить некоторые двоичные файлы, такие как pg_cti.exe, pg_dump.exe и pg_restore.exe.
От ' Адрес ” скопируйте путь, по которому находится бинарный файл psql.exe:
Шаг 6: Откройте переменную среды
Открой ' Редактировать переменные системной среды », выполнив поиск « Переменные среды ' в ' Запускать меню:
Шаг 7: Установите переменную среды пути
Нажмите ' Переменные среды », чтобы открыть окно переменных среды:
Выбрать ' Дорожка ” имущество от “ Системные переменные », затем нажмите « Редактировать ' кнопка:
Ударь ' Новый ” и вставьте сюда скопированный путь, как показано ниже. Для сохранения изменений используйте кнопку « ХОРОШО ' кнопка:
Шаг 8. Проверьте установку только клиентских инструментов
На следующем шаге откройте командную строку и введите « psql ' здесь:
Вы можете видеть, что он покажет сообщение об ошибке, потому что мы установили только клиентский инструмент, а не сервер PostgreSQL:
Способ 2: использование установщика PostgreSQL
Чтобы установить только клиентские инструменты для PostgreSQL в Windows с помощью установщика PostgreSQL, выполните указанные ниже действия.
Шаг 1: Загрузите установщик PostgreSQL
Во-первых, перейдите по ссылке ниже, чтобы загрузить установщик PostgreSQL для Windows:
Шаг 2: Запустите установщик PostgreSQL
Перейти к « Загрузки ” и дважды щелкните установщик PostgreSQL, чтобы запустить его:
Шаг 3. Установите только клиентские инструменты PostgreSQL.
Чтобы начать установку PostgreSQL, нажмите кнопку « Следующий ” в “ Настраивать ' Окно:
Выберите место для установки PostgreSQL. Затем нажмите кнопку « Следующий ' кнопка:
Шаг 4. Выберите клиентский инструмент PostgreSQL.
Предположим, нам нужен только клиентский инструмент командной строки, затем снимите все остальные компоненты и нажмите « Следующий ' кнопка:
На следующем шаге просмотрите сводную информацию об установке и перейдите к следующему шагу, нажав кнопку « Следующий ' кнопка:
Наконец, установите выбранный клиентский инструмент, нажав кнопку « Следующий ' кнопка:
Мы успешно установили клиентский инструмент командной строки PostgreSQL в Windows:
Шаг 5: Установите переменную среды пути
На следующем шаге перейдите в папку установки PostgreSQL, откройте каталог bin и скопируйте путь из « Адрес ' бар:
Открой ' Отредактируйте системные переменные среды ” настройка путем поиска “ Переменные среды ' в ' Запускать меню:
Нажми на ' Переменные среды ' кнопка:
Установите переменные среды Path, выбрав « Дорожка ” имущество от “ Системные переменные » и нажав на кнопку « Редактировать ' кнопка:
Чтобы добавить новый путь, нажмите « Новый ” и вставьте скопированный путь. Затем нажмите на кнопку « ХОРОШО ” для сохранения изменений:
Шаг 6: Откройте командную строку
Сделайте поиск по запросу « CMD ' в ' Запускать » и откройте командную строку из результатов поиска:
Шаг 7. Проверьте установку клиентского инструмента
Теперь выполните приведенную ниже команду, чтобы убедиться, что сервер PostgreSQL не работает в системе:
Приведенный ниже вывод показывает, что мы установили только клиентский инструмент в Windows, а сервер PostgreSQL не запущен в системе:
Мы разработали способы установки клиентских инструментов PostgreSQL только в Windows.
Вывод
Чтобы установить только клиентские инструменты для PostgreSQL, вы можете использовать сжатый установочный файл PostgreSQL или программу установки PostgreSQL. При первом подходе распаковывался установочный файл и удалялись все ненужные каталоги и двоичные файлы. Чтобы использовать PostgreSQL в командной строке, установите переменную среды path. Во втором подходе загрузите и запустите установщик. Во время установки выберите только нужные клиентские инструменты PostgreSQL и установите их. Мы продемонстрировали подходы к установке клиентских инструментов PostgreSQL только в Windows.